- Cut the zucchini lengthwise with a mandolin very thin.
- Place the zucchini in a bowl with the sliced leeks; season with salt and pepper.
- Drizzle over the olive oil and lemon juice.
- Mix gently.
- At this point you can refrigerate the dish to let the flavors blend.
- When ready to serve, place on serving dish and top with shaved slices of parmesan.
